Philippine Agenda for the Adaptation Finance Accountability Initiative

The project will pursue engagement with the Climate Change Commission (CCC) including establishement of a partnership through a Memorandum of Agreement aimed at (1) development of policy briefs to inform the operational rules of the PSF and ensure the effective application of provisions on direct access, transparency and accountability; and (2) development of tracking tools to monitor adaptation finance flows. This will also pursue engagement with the Climate Finance Group (CFG) particularly the Department of Finance which is the institution mandanted to manage donor funds coming into the country.
